Specifications for building envelopes may be wholly bespoke or follow one
of the recognised building envelope specifications. However, all
specifications have to be customised to take account of the external climate
and the building use.
The CWCT ‘Standard for systemised building envelopes’ gives a framework
for specifying building envelopes and provides a ‘Specifiers checklist’
showing information that will change from project to project. This
includes:
-
Internal and external environment
-
Air permeability
-
Thermal performance
-
Access and safety
-
Design life
Both the National Building Specification (NBS) and National House Building
Council (NHBC) standards are based on the CWCT ‘Standard for systemised
building envelopes’. There are many British Standards relating to
building envelopes but simply listing standards is no substitute for a
comprehensive specification.
